package task
import (
"context"
"fmt"
"os"
"github.com/hibiken/asynq"
"github.com/redis/go-redis/v9"
"go.uber.org/zap"
"github.com/break/junhong_cmp_fiber/internal/exporter"
"github.com/break/junhong_cmp_fiber/internal/store/postgres"
"github.com/break/junhong_cmp_fiber/pkg/constants"
"github.com/break/junhong_cmp_fiber/pkg/storage"
)
// ExportFinalizeHandler 导出 finalize 处理器。
type ExportFinalizeHandler struct {
redis *redis.Client
taskStore *postgres.ExportTaskStore
shardStore *postgres.ExportShardTaskStore
storageSvc *storage.Service
sceneRegistry *exporter.Registry
logger *zap.Logger
}
// NewExportFinalizeHandler 创建导出 finalize 处理器。
func NewExportFinalizeHandler(
redis *redis.Client,
taskStore *postgres.ExportTaskStore,
shardStore *postgres.ExportShardTaskStore,
storageSvc *storage.Service,
sceneRegistry *exporter.Registry,
logger *zap.Logger,
) *ExportFinalizeHandler {
return &ExportFinalizeHandler{
redis: redis,
taskStore: taskStore,
shardStore: shardStore,
storageSvc: storageSvc,
sceneRegistry: sceneRegistry,
logger: logger,
}
}
// HandleExportFinalize 处理导出 finalize 任务。
func (h *ExportFinalizeHandler) HandleExportFinalize(ctx context.Context, task *asynq.Task) error {
var payload ExportFinalizePayload
if err := parseExportPayload(task.Payload(), &payload); err != nil {
h.logger.Error("解析导出 finalize 任务载荷失败", zap.Error(err))
return asynq.SkipRetry
}
lockKey := constants.RedisExportFinalizeLockKey(payload.TaskID)
locked, err := tryAcquireLock(ctx, h.redis, lockKey, exportFinalizeLockTTL)
if err != nil {
return err
}
if !locked {
return nil
}
defer releaseLock(ctx, h.redis, lockKey)
exportTask, err := h.taskStore.GetByIDForWorker(ctx, payload.TaskID)
if err != nil {
h.logger.Error("查询导出任务失败", zap.Uint("task_id", payload.TaskID), zap.Error(err))
return asynq.SkipRetry
}
if exportTask.Status == constants.ExportTaskStatusCompleted || exportTask.Status == constants.ExportTaskStatusFailed || exportTask.Status == constants.ExportTaskStatusCancelled {
return nil
}
updater := dispatchUpdater(exportTask)
if exportTask.CancelRequested {
if err := h.shardStore.CancelByTaskID(ctx, exportTask.ID, updater, "任务已取消"); err != nil {
return err
}
if err := h.taskStore.MarkCancelledByWorker(ctx, exportTask.ID, updater, "任务已取消"); err != nil {
return err
}
return nil
}
unfinishedCount, err := h.shardStore.CountUnfinishedByTaskID(ctx, exportTask.ID)
if err != nil {
return err
}
if unfinishedCount > 0 {
return fmt.Errorf("分片任务尚未完成: %d", unfinishedCount)
}
failedCount, err := h.shardStore.CountByTaskIDAndStatus(ctx, exportTask.ID, constants.ExportShardStatusFailed)
if err != nil {
return err
}
if failedCount > 0 {
if err := h.taskStore.MarkFailed(ctx, exportTask.ID, updater, "存在失败分片,导出任务失败"); err != nil {
return err
}
return nil
}
strategy, ok := h.sceneRegistry.Get(exportTask.Scene)
if !ok {
if err := h.taskStore.MarkFailed(ctx, exportTask.ID, updater, "导出场景未注册"); err != nil {
return err
}
return nil
}
shards, err := h.shardStore.ListByTaskID(ctx, exportTask.ID)
if err != nil {
return err
}
rows := make([][]string, 0)
for _, shard := range shards {
if shard.Status != constants.ExportShardStatusSuccess {
continue
}
currentRows, err := strategy.QueryRows(ctx, exportTask, shard.CursorStart, shard.CursorEnd)
if err != nil {
return h.handleFinalizeError(ctx, exportTask.ID, updater, "读取分片数据失败", err)
}
rows = append(rows, currentRows...)
}
localPath, fileSize, err := writeExportFile(exportTask.Format, strategy.Headers(), rows)
if err != nil {
return h.handleFinalizeError(ctx, exportTask.ID, updater, "生成汇总文件失败", err)
}
defer func() { _ = os.Remove(localPath) }()
fileName := fmt.Sprintf("%s.%s", exportTask.TaskNo, exportTask.Format)
fileKey, err := uploadExportFile(ctx, h.storageSvc, localPath, fileName)
if err != nil {
return h.handleFinalizeError(ctx, exportTask.ID, updater, "上传汇总文件失败", err)
}
if err := h.taskStore.MarkCompleted(ctx, exportTask.ID, updater, fileKey, fileSize); err != nil {
return err
}
return nil
}
func (h *ExportFinalizeHandler) handleFinalizeError(ctx context.Context, taskID uint, updater uint, prefix string, err error) error {
if isFinalRetry(ctx) {
markErr := h.taskStore.MarkFailed(ctx, taskID, updater, prefix+": "+err.Error())
if markErr != nil {
return markErr
}
return nil
}
return err
}
